s3:utils: Fix NULL check
[samba.git] / source3 / lib / dbwrap / dbwrap_ctdb.c
2022-07-01 Stefan Metzmachers3:dbwrap_ctdb: improve the error handling in ctdb_asyn...
2021-06-04 Volker Lendeckedbwrap_ctdb: Remove "tryonly" from fetch_locked_internal()
2021-06-04 Volker Lendeckedbwrap: Remove "db_context->try_fetch_locked()" fn...
2020-04-28 Volker Lendeckelib: Use ctdbd_req_send/recv in ctdb_parse_send/recv
2020-04-02 Swen Schilligdbwrap: fix possible memleak and false result check.
2020-04-02 Swen Schilligdbwrap: fix comment in code leading to wrong function...
2020-01-23 Volker Lendeckedbwrap: Do direct struct initalization in db_ctdb_store...
2020-01-20 Martin Schwenkes3: lib: dbwrap_ctdb: Ensure value_valid is set when...
2020-01-13 Jeremy Allisons3: lib: dbwrap. Cleanup. Add a couple of missing ...
2020-01-13 Jeremy Allisons3: lib: dbwrap_ctdb: Ensure value_valid is set true...
2020-01-08 Anoop C Ss3: lib: dbwrap: Set rec->value_valid to avoid backtrac...
2019-11-22 Volker Lendeckedbwrap: Protect against invalid db_record->value
2019-07-24 Noel Powers3/lib/dbwrap: clang: Fix 'Access to field results...
2019-07-24 Noel Powers3/lib/dwrap: clang: Fix 'Value stored to 'ret' is...
2018-09-12 Ralph Boehmedbwrap_ctdb: return correct record count for a persiste...
2018-09-12 Ralph Boehmedbwrap_ctdb: increment record count in traverse_callback()
2018-09-12 Ralph Boehmedbwrap_ctdb: use struct initializer in db_ctdb_traverse()
2018-09-12 Ralph Boehmedbwrap_ctdb: use struct initializer in db_ctdb_traverse...
2018-09-12 Ralph Boehmedbwrap_ctdb: README.Coding fixes in traverse_callback()
2018-09-12 Ralph Boehmedbwrap_ctdb: simplify if condition
2018-09-12 Ralph Boehmedbwrap_ctdb: add error checking to ctdbd_dbpath()
2018-02-08 Volker Lendeckelib: Make g_lock_unlock use TDB_DATA
2018-02-08 Volker Lendeckelib: Make g_lock_lock use TDB_DATA
2017-07-25 Volker Lendeckectdb_conn: Use messaging_ctdb_connection
2017-07-25 Volker Lendeckedbwrap_ctdb: Use messaging_ctdbd_connection
2017-07-25 Volker Lendeckedbwrap: Avoid dbwrap_merge_dbufs in db_ctdb_storev
2017-07-25 Volker Lendeckedbwrap: Convert backend store to storev
2017-07-19 Amitay Isaacsdbwrap_ctdb: Fix calculation of persistent flag
2017-07-12 Ralph Boehmedbwrap: Ask CTDB for local tdb open flags
2017-07-12 Ralph Boehmectdbd_conn: pass persistent bool instead of tdb_flags
2017-07-12 Ralph Boehmectdbd_conn: move CTDB_CONTROL_ENABLE_SEQNUM control...
2017-06-24 Volker Lendeckelib: Use ctdb_protocol instead of ctdb_private
2017-06-21 Volker Lendeckelib: Fix typos
2017-05-10 Volker Lendeckedbwrap_ctdb: Fix a typo
2017-05-07 Ralph Boehmes3/dbwrap_ctdb: free resources in an error code path
2017-05-07 Ralph Boehmes3/dbwrap_ctdb: set async_ctx to initialized
2017-04-18 Ralph Boehmedbwrap_ctdb: implement parse_record_send()/recv()
2017-04-18 Ralph Boehmedbwrap_ctdb: factor out a db_ctdb_try_parse_local_recor...
2016-09-14 Amitay Isaacss3-ctdb: Use correct db_id size in marshalling record...
2016-08-29 Volker Lendeckedbwrap: Use tdb_storev in dbwrap_ctdb
2016-08-09 Ralph Boehmedbwrap_ctdb: treat empty records in ltdb as non-existing
2016-07-25 Amitay Isaacsdbwrap_ctdb: Remove setting of database priority from...
2016-07-15 Volker Lendeckedbwrap: Remove dbwrap_watchers.tdb based code
2016-05-17 Volker Lendeckedbwrap_ctdb: Remove get_my_vnn dependency
2016-05-17 Volker Lendeckedbwrap_ctdb: Fix some 32-bit hickups
2016-05-17 Volker Lendeckedbwrap: Add "msg_ctx" to db_open_ctdb
2016-05-17 Volker Lendeckedbwrap_ctdb: Pass in ctdbd_connection
2016-05-17 Volker Lendeckedbwrap_ctdb: Add "conn" to db_ctdb_ctx
2016-05-17 Volker Lendeckedbwrap_ctdb: Align loop index with terminator
2016-04-26 Volker Lendeckedbwrap_ctdb: Fix ENOENT->NT_STATUS_NOT_FOUND
2016-04-25 Volker Lendeckectdbd_conn: Make "cstatus" int32_t
2016-04-25 Volker Lendeckelib: Move ctdbd_init_connection out of ctdbd_traverse()
2015-11-03 Amitay Isaacsctdb-daemon: Rename struct ctdb_rec_data to ctdb_rec_da...
2015-10-28 Amitay Isaacsctdb-include: Remove unused header file include/ctdb.h
2015-10-21 Christof SchmittRemove function name from callers of DBG_*
2015-10-14 Volker Lendeckelib: Fix CID 1327227 Uninitialized scalar variable
2015-10-07 Volker Lendeckelib: Make ctdbd_control_local return 0/errno
2015-10-07 Volker Lendeckelib: Make ctdbd_traverse return 0/errno
2015-10-07 Volker Lendeckelib: Make ctdbd_parse return 0/errno
2015-10-07 Volker Lendeckelib: Make ctdbd_migrate return 0/errno
2015-10-07 Volker Lendeckelib: Make ctdbd_db_attach return 0/errno
2015-10-06 Volker Lendeckelib: Fix CID 1128553 Unchecked return value from library
2015-10-02 Volker Lendeckelib: Move lp_ctdbd_socket() to cluster_support.c
2015-10-02 Volker Lendeckelib: Pass parameters to ctdbd_init_connection()
2015-09-22 Volker Lendeckedbwrap: Make dbwrap_db_id return size_t
2015-03-17 Volker Lendeckelib: Remove tdb_compat
2015-03-17 Volker Lendeckelib: Remove tdb_fetch_compat
2014-11-16 Volker Lendeckedbwrap_ctdb: Pass on mutex flags to tdb_open
2014-10-28 Amitay Isaacsbuild: Remove checks for ctdb features
2014-06-27 Volker Lendeckedbwrap: Print wait times with full precision
2014-05-24 Volker Lendeckedbwrap_ctdb: open locally with TDB_VOLATILE if requested
2014-03-31 Volker Lendecketdb_wrap: Remove tdb_wrap_open_ again
2014-03-31 Volker Lendeckedbwrap: Avoid passing lp_ctx to tdb_wrap_open in db_ope...
2014-03-24 Stefan Metzmachers3:wscript: only build ctdb_dummy.c if we have no clust...
2014-03-24 Stefan Metzmachers3:lib: move all ctdb related dummy functions to ctdb_d...
2014-03-03 Michael Adamdbwrap_ctdb: avoid smbd/ctdb deadlocks: check whether...
2014-02-07 Stefan Metzmacherdbwrap_ctdb: implement DBWRAP_FLAG_OPTIMIZE_READONLY_ACCESS
2014-02-07 Michael Adamdbwrap: add a dbwrap_flags argument to db_open_ctdb()
2014-01-16 Christof Schmitts3:dbwrap: Use milliseconds for "Held tdb lock" message
2014-01-16 Christof Schmitts3:dbwrap: Store warning thresholds in db_ctdb_ctx
2014-01-16 Christian Ambachs3:dbwrap include the hashchain in the logs
2014-01-16 Christian Ambachs3:dbwrap report time for chainlock and CTDB migrate
2014-01-16 Volker Lendeckedbwrap_ctdb: Instrument chainunlock timing
2014-01-16 Volker Lendeckectdb_conn: Log long fetch_lock calls
2013-11-13 Stefan MetzmacherMerge branch 'master' of ctdb into 'master' of samba
2013-08-28 Volker Lendeckedbwrap_ctdb: Treat empty records as non-existing
2013-05-16 Christian Ambachs3:lib/dbwrap add missing curly braces
2013-03-26 Volker Lendeckedbwrap-ctdb: Avoid a talloc_stackframe()
2013-03-26 Volker Lendeckedbwrap-ctdb: Use ctdbd_parse in db_ctdb_parse_record
2013-03-25 Volker Lendeckedbwrap: Use tdb_null in db_ctdb_delete
2013-02-04 Michael Adams3:dbrwap_ctdb: ZERO_STRUCT(rec) just to be sure in...
2013-02-04 Michael Adams3:dbwrap_ctdb: ZERO_STRUCT(rec) just to be sure in...
2013-02-04 Stefan Metzmachers3:dbwrap_ctdb: add "db_context" to "db_record"
2013-02-04 Stefan Metzmachers3:dbwrap_ctdb: setup result->name in db_open_ctdb()
2012-11-29 Volker Lendeckes3: Remove db_ctdb_fetch
2012-11-29 Volker Lendeckes3: Directly parse local existing records in db_ctdb_pa...
2012-11-29 Volker Lendeckes3: Factor out db_ctdb_can_use_local_hdr from db_ctdb_c...
2012-11-29 Volker Lendeckes3: Remove unused code for fetching persistent ctdb...
2012-11-29 Volker Lendeckes3: Avoid db_ctdb_fetch for persistent databases
2012-11-29 Volker Lendeckes3: Factor out parse_newest_in_marshall_buffer from...